Spring Valley Country Club

Designed by William B. Langford, ASGCA/Theodore J. Moreaux and opened in 1927
Spring Valley - Salem, Wisconsin

Course Details

Holes:
18
Par:
70
Length:
6354 yards
Slope:
119
Rating:
70.1
Driving Ranges:
Yes
Estimated Green Fees
$45
These rates are an estimate of what you might expect to pay at Spring Valley with a cart. Actual rates may vary.
Fees are typically lowest Monday through Thursday and during twilight (late afternoon and evenings). Expect to pay the highest rates on weekends.

This golf course is a golfer's dream. This course was designed by William Langford in 1926 and it contains classic and memorable holes. Langford is famous for his huge, bold green complexes and they are preserved and on display here. There are 5 great par-3's. No. 3 is a classic Redan. #5 is a gorgeous cape hole (one of the coolest holes around). #14 is a drivable par-4. #16 is a well designed Alps hole. It is very hilly and walking the course is difficult. A terrific joy to play this course and the food and the staff are great. There is cold drinking water near the 15th tee and a bathroom at the top of the hill left of the 15th green.
